When it comes to keeping your 2022 Toyota Sienna running smoothly, paying attention to your fuel injector seal kits is crucial! These little seals play a big role in maintaining a proper fuel system, ensuring that the fuel flows efficiently and your engine operates optimally. To keep them in great shape, make sure to regularly inspect for wear and tear, and address any leaks promptly. Common symptoms of failing fuel injector seals include rough idling, decreased fuel efficiency, and even noticeable fuel odors. When you’re gearing up to replace your Fuel Injector Seal Kit, it’s essential to have a few related products on hand to make the job smoother. You might want to grab some new O-rings or gaskets to ensure a tight seal and prevent any pesky leaks. Don’t forget about cleaning supplies; a throttle body cleaner can help clear out any gunk that’s built up around the injectors. As for tools, having a torque wrench is crucial for reassembling everything to manufacturer specifications, and a set of socket wrenches will make removing the old seals much easier. Safety is key when diving into this project—make sure you wear gloves to protect your hands from fuel and use safety glasses to guard against any debris that might come loose during the process. Keep a fire extinguisher nearby, just in case, and always work in a well-ventilated area to avoid inhaling harmful fumes. Happy wrenching!
